coastal — 形容詞
1. located on, near, or connected with the land along the edge of the sea

located on, near, or connected with the land along the edge of the sea
The coastal road from Hana's hometown to the next village offers beautiful ocean views.

coastal + road (collocation for routes by the sea)
Kofi works as a guide for tourists who want to explore the coastal region.

coastal + region (collocation for geographic areas)
Many coastal towns in the south rely on fishing and tourism for their income.

Rising sea levels are a serious problem for communities living in coastal areas.

The coastal path along the cliffs is a popular walking route for visitors.

- inland
describes the interior of a country away from the coast
- landlocked
describes a place completely surrounded by land with no direct access to the sea

coastal + noun

Commonly appears before nouns related to geography, settlement, or the environment — frequent in news reports about climate change, tourism, and urban planning.
